About This Book
Jessica Wakefield is sure of one thing: her best friend Lila isn’t really her best friend anymore. Then a mysterious message in a bottle washes ashore, offering a secret friendship that could change everything. But can a friend you've never met be the friend you really need?

Quick Assessment
This early reader story explores themes of friendship and reconciliation as Jessica navigates a lost friendship and discovers a new secret friend through a message in a bottle. Suitable for children ages 5-8, it gently addresses social emotions and the importance of connection without intense conflict or distress.
